Using Traps and Monitoring Devices
Using traps and monitoring devices is an effective way to detect pest infestations early on. Sticky traps are a popular choice for catching flying pests like aphids, whiteflies, and thrips. These adhesive-coated surfaces trap the pests, allowing you to monitor their population and make informed decisions about management.
Pheromone traps are another type of monitoring device that uses synthetic pheromones to attract specific pest species. For example, codling moth traps use a pheromone lure that mimics the scent of a female codling moth, drawing in male moths that can then be trapped and counted. By monitoring the number of pests caught in these traps, you can determine the severity of an infestation and take targeted action to control it.
When setting up sticky or pheromone traps, choose locations where pests are most likely to congregate, such as near plants with high pest pressure or in areas with recent pest activity. Regularly check the traps to monitor pest populations and make adjustments to your management strategy as needed.

Neem Oil and Other Natural Pesticides
When it comes to controlling garden pests, many of us turn to chemical-based pesticides. However, these chemicals can harm not only the targeted pests but also beneficial insects and even people and pets that come into contact with them. Fortunately, there are effective and safer alternatives like neem oil and other natural pesticides.
Neem oil is extracted from the seeds of the neem tree (Azadirachta indica) and has been used for centuries in traditional Indian medicine to control pests. It’s a broad-spectrum pesticide that can be used to control a wide range of pests, including insects, mites, and even fungal diseases. To use neem oil effectively, mix it with water according to the label instructions and spray it on the affected plants. Be sure to spray the undersides of leaves and stems as well, as this is where many pests tend to hide.
Some other natural pesticides worth considering include pyrethrin sprays derived from chrysanthemum flowers, insecticidal soap, and horticultural oil. These alternatives may require more frequent applications than chemical pesticides but are generally safer for the environment and human health. When using any pesticide, be sure to follow the label instructions carefully and take necessary precautions to avoid exposure.

Monitoring and Record Keeping
Regular monitoring and record keeping are crucial components of effective pest management. By tracking weather patterns, soil conditions, and pest activity, you can anticipate potential infestations and take proactive measures to prevent them. Start by creating a logbook or spreadsheet to document observations, note any changes in plant health, and record the presence of pests.
Pay attention to seasonal fluctuations in pest populations. For example, aphids are more common during warm, dry periods, while slugs thrive in moist environments. Keep an eye on temperature and precipitation forecasts to anticipate when conditions might become favorable for certain pests.
When monitoring soil conditions, look for signs of nutrient deficiencies or waterlogging, which can attract pests. Also, keep track of the type and timing of irrigation, as overwatering can lead to root rot and other issues. Regularly inspect plants for early warning signs of infestation, such as discoloration, distorted growth, or actual pests visible on the surface.
By maintaining accurate records and staying attuned to environmental conditions, you’ll be better equipped to identify garden pests before they become serious problems. This will enable you to respond promptly with targeted control measures, minimizing harm to your plants while protecting the ecosystem.

Maintaining a Healthy Garden Ecosystem
Maintaining a healthy garden ecosystem is crucial to preventing future pest infestations. By adopting some simple strategies, you can create an environment that fosters balance and diversity, making it harder for pests to thrive.
Crop rotation is one effective technique for promoting soil health and reducing pest populations. This involves changing the location of different crops within your garden each season, which breaks the life cycle of pests and prevents them from adapting to specific conditions. For example, if you grew tomatoes in a particular spot last season, try planting something else like broccoli or carrots this time around.
Soil management is also vital for maintaining a balanced ecosystem. This includes practices like composting, mulching, and avoiding over-tilling, which helps retain moisture and nutrients while reducing the risk of soil-borne pests. By creating a diverse range of microorganisms in your soil through these methods, you’ll build a robust defense against pests.
Promoting biodiversity is another key strategy for maintaining a healthy garden ecosystem. This can be achieved by planting a variety of flowers, herbs, and vegetables that attract beneficial insects like bees, butterflies, and ladybugs. These natural predators feed on pests, keeping their populations under control and reducing the need for chemical pesticides.
